Understanding Your Goals
Before embarking on any fitness journey, it’s crucial to define your goals. Are you looking to lose weight, build muscle, improve endurance, or enhance overall wellness? Understanding your objectives will help tailor your fitness plan effectively.
Set SMART Goals
One effective method for goal setting is the SMART criteria:
Specific: Clearly define what you want to achieve. Instead of saying, "I want to get fit," specify, "I want to run a 5K in under 30 minutes."
Measurable: Ensure that your goals can be tracked. For example, "I will lose 10 pounds in three months."
Achievable: Set realistic goals based on your current fitness level. If you’re new to exercise, aiming for a marathon in a month may not be feasible.
Relevant: Your goals should align with your overall health aspirations. If your priority is to improve cardiovascular health, focus on activities that support that.
Time-bound: Set a deadline for your goals. This creates a sense of urgency and helps keep you accountable.
Creating a Balanced Workout Plan
A well-rounded fitness program should include a mix of cardiovascular exercise, strength training, and flexibility work. Here’s how to structure your workouts:
Cardiovascular Exercise
Cardio is essential for heart health and burning calories.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ity each week. Options include:
Running or jogging
Cycling
Swimming
Dancing
Strength Training
Incorporating strength training into your routine helps build muscle and boost metabolism. Aim for two to three sessions per week, targeting all major muscle groups. Consider:
Bodyweight exercises (push-ups, squats)
Free weights (dumbbells, kettlebells)
Resistance bands
Flexibility and Mobility
Don’t overlook the importance of flexibility and mobility work. Incorporate stretching and mobility exercises to improve range of motion and prevent injuries. Activities like yoga or Pilates can be beneficial.
Nutrition Matters
Fitness coaching isn’t just about exercise; nutrition plays a vital role in achieving health goals. Here are some tips for maintaining a balanced diet:
Focus on Whole Foods
Prioritize whole, unprocessed foods in your diet. This includes:
Fruits and vegetables
Whole grains
Lean proteins (chicken, fish, legumes)
Healthy fats (avocado, nuts, olive oil)
Stay Hydrated
Hydration is crucial for overall health and performance. Aim to drink at least eight glasses of water a day, and more if you’re exercising intensely.
Meal Planning
Planning your meals can help you stay on track with your nutrition goals. Consider preparing meals in advance to avoid unhealthy choices when you’re busy.
The Importance of Rest and Recovery
Rest and recovery are often overlooked but are essential components of any fitness program. Here’s why they matter:
Preventing Burnout
Overtraining can lead to burnout and injuries. Ensure you schedule rest days into your routine to allow your body to recover.
Quality Sleep
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night. Sleep is crucial for muscle recovery and overall health.
Active Recovery
Incorporate active recovery days into your routine. Activities like walking, light yoga, or stretching can help your body recover while keeping you active.
Staying Motivated
Staying motivated can be one of the biggest challenges in a fitness journey. Here are some strategies to keep your spirits high:
Find a Workout Buddy
Working out with a friend can make exercise more enjoyable and hold you accountable. You’re less likely to skip a workout if someone else is counting on you.
Track Your Progress
Keep a journal or use fitness apps to track your workouts and progress. Seeing how far you’ve come can be a great motivator.
Celebrate Small Wins
Acknowledge and celebrate your achievements, no matter how small. Whether it’s lifting a heavier weight or completing an extra mile, every step counts.
